Веб-разработка — это сложный и увлекательный процесс, требующий множества технологий и инструментов. Когда дело доходит до создания и запуска веб-приложений, веб-разработчики сталкиваются с рядом вызовов и проблем. Одной из таких проблем является выбор подходящего хостинга для их приложений. Виртуальные частные серверы (VPS) приходят на помощь веб-разработчикам, предоставляя им полный контроль над окружением и ресурсами сервера.
С VPS веб-разработчики могут создавать и запускать веб-приложения без ограничений, настраивая сервер по своему усмотрению. Они могут выбирать операционную систему, устанавливать необходимые программы и настраивать серверное окружение в соответствии с требованиями их приложений. Кроме того, виртуальный частный сервер предоставляет разработчикам выделенные ресурсы, такие как процессор, оперативная память и дисковое пространство, что обеспечивает оптимальную производительность и скорость работы веб-приложений.
Еще одним преимуществом VPS для веб-разработчиков является высокий уровень безопасности. Виртуальные частные серверы обеспечивают разработчикам изолированное окружение, где они могут выполнить все необходимые меры безопасности. Они могут установить фаерволлы, антивирусные программы и другие меры безопасности для защиты своих веб-приложений от вредоносных атак и утечки данных. Кроме того, VPS-хостинг обеспечивает возможность резервного копирования данных, что является важным аспектом для веб-разработчиков, чтобы избежать потери данных и восстановить приложения в случае сбоев или сбоев.
- Преимущества использования VPS для разработчиков
- Удобство и безопасность
- Функциональность и гибкость рабочего окружения
- Изоляция и защита данных
- Быстрое развертывание и масштабирование
- Доступность и надежность
- Возможность удаленного доступа и управления
- Гарантированная доступность и высокая скорость работы
Преимущества использования VPS для разработчиков
Полный контроль
Используя VPS, разработчики получают полный контроль над своим серверным окружением. Они могут настраивать серверы, устанавливать необходимое программное обеспечение и выбирать оптимальные параметры для работы их приложений. Это позволяет им создавать и тестировать приложения в контролируемой среде.
Гибкость и масштабируемость
VPS позволяет разработчикам масштабировать свои веб-приложения в зависимости от требований проекта. Они могут легко добавлять или удалять ресурсы, такие как процессоры, оперативная память, дисковое пространство, в соответствии с растущей нагрузкой на приложение. Это обеспечивает гибкость и экономическую эффективность.
Безопасность
VPS предоставляет высокий уровень безопасности для веб-разработчиков и их приложений. Разработчики имеют возможность настроить свои собственные правила безопасности, установить SSL-сертификаты и мониторить свои серверы на наличие вредоносного кода или атак. Это помогает предотвратить возможные угрозы и обеспечить надежную работу приложений.
Отказоустойчивость
С использованием VPS разработчики получают доступ к высокоотказным серверным решениям. VPS работает на физическом сервере с резервным оборудованием и сетевыми соединениями, что обеспечивает продолжительную работу приложений даже в случае возникновения сбоев или отключений. Это гарантирует непрерывность работы веб-приложений.
Использование VPS становится все более популярным среди веб-разработчиков, и по хорошей причине. Он предоставляет надежное и гибкое решение для создания и запуска веб-приложений, а также обеспечивает полный контроль и безопасность.
Удобство и безопасность
Использование VPS при создании и запуске веб-приложений позволяет веб-разработчикам насладиться удобством и безопасностью своей работы.
Удобство заключается в том, что VPS предоставляет разработчику полный контроль над своими ресурсами. Он может настроить серверное окружение с учетом своих специфических потребностей, установить необходимые программы и библиотеки, а также настроить конфигурацию сервера для достижения оптимальной производительности. Одновременно, VPS предлагает гибкую и масштабируемую структуру, позволяя легко увеличивать или уменьшать выделенные ресурсы в зависимости от потребностей проекта.
Кроме того, безопасность является одним из ключевых аспектов при работе с веб-приложениями. VPS обеспечивает высокий уровень безопасности, так как разработчик полностью контролирует доступ к своему серверу. Это позволяет применять необходимые меры для защиты от взломов и злоумышленников, как например установка брандмауэра, регулярное обновление программного обеспечения и применение различных методов шифрования.
Таким образом, использование VPS при создании и запуске веб-приложений дает веб-разработчикам удобство и безопасность, что позволяет им сосредоточиться на своей работе и достичь оптимальных результатов.
Функциональность и гибкость рабочего окружения
Один из основных преимуществ VPS для веб-разработчиков заключается в его функциональности и гибкости. Пользователь имеет полный контроль над своим виртуальным сервером и может настроить его в соответствии с требованиями своего проекта.
Веб-разработчики могут выбрать операционную систему, которая лучше всего подходит для выполнения их задач. Они могут использовать любые языки программирования и базы данных, установить нужное программное обеспечение и настроить конфигурацию сервера в соответствии со своими потребностями.
Кроме того, VPS предоставляет возможность горизонтального и вертикального масштабирования. Это означает, что веб-разработчики могут легко увеличить мощность сервера, чтобы обрабатывать больше трафика или добавить дополнительные ресурсы для выполнения более сложных задач. Также можно установить и использовать различные инструменты разработки и утилиты, чтобы улучшить эффективность работы над проектом.
Благодаря своей гибкости, VPS позволяет веб-разработчикам быстро реагировать на изменения требований проекта. Если нужно изменить конфигурацию сервера, добавить новые фреймворки или библиотеки, это можно сделать без проблем.
В целом, функциональность и гибкость рабочего окружения VPS делает его идеальным выбором для веб-разработчиков, которые хотят иметь полный контроль над своими проектами и создавать и запускать веб-приложения с минимальными ограничениями.
Изоляция и защита данных
Веб-разработчикам очень важно обеспечить безопасность данных и защитить их от несанкционированного доступа или утечки. VPS предоставляет специальные механизмы для обеспечения изоляции данных между разными веб-приложениями и пользователями.
Виртуализация, используемая в VPS, позволяет разместить каждое веб-приложение на отдельном виртуальном сервере. Это означает, что данные, используемые одним веб-приложением, будут физически отделены от данных другого приложения. Такая изоляция обеспечивает более высокий уровень безопасности и повышает защиту от возможных атак.
Кроме того, VPS предлагает возможность настройки различных уровней доступа и авторизации. Веб-разработчики могут установить правила доступа к своим веб-приложениям, такие как пароли, двухфакторная аутентификация или IP-фильтры. Это позволяет контролировать доступ к данным и предотвращает несанкционированный доступ.
Дополнительно, с помощью VPS разработчики могут создавать резервные копии данных своих веб-приложений. Это очень важно, чтобы предотвратить потерю данных и сохранить их целостность. Если что-то пойдет не так, разработчики могут восстановить данные из резервных копий и продолжить работу с минимальными потерями.
Иногда возникает необходимость в обработке конфиденциальных данных, таких как номера кредитных карт или личные данные пользователей. VPS позволяет использовать SSL-сертификаты для шифрования данных, передаваемых между веб-приложением и пользователем. Это обеспечивает дополнительный уровень защиты данных и повышает доверие пользователей к веб-приложению.
Суммируя, VPS предоставляет веб-разработчикам мощные инструменты для изоляции и защиты данных. Это помогает обеспечить безопасность и конфиденциальность данных веб-приложений, а также предотвратить потерю информации или утечку данных. Создание и запуск веб-приложений на VPS является надежным и безопасным выбором для веб-разработчиков.
Быстрое развертывание и масштабирование
Развертывание веб-приложений на VPS очень просто и быстро. Вам не нужно покупать и настраивать физические серверы, что может занять много времени и требовать больших затрат. С помощью VPS вы можете виртуализировать ваш сервер, создать инстанс, установить необходимые операционные системы и программное обеспечение. Все это займет всего несколько минут.
Кроме того, VPS позволяет быстро масштабировать ваше веб-приложение. Если ваше приложение начинает получать больше трафика и нуждается в дополнительных ресурсах, вы можете легко увеличить объем выделенной памяти, процессора и хранилища на вашем VPS. В некоторых случаях это может быть сделано всего в несколько кликов.
Когда вы используете VPS для развертывания и масштабирования веб-приложений, вы также имеете гибкость выбора операционной системы, баз данных и другого программного обеспечения, необходимого для вашего приложения. Это позволяет вам настроить вашу среду разработки и запускать приложение в окружении, наиболее подходящем для ваших потребностей.
В целом, использование VPS для развертывания и масштабирования веб-приложений дает разработчикам гибкость, скорость и простоту в создании и управлении своими проектами. Этот инструмент позволяет сосредоточиться на разработке самого приложения, не отвлекаясь на сложности инфраструктуры и серверного администрирования.
Доступность и надежность
VPS предоставляет высокую степень надежности, так как виртуальные серверы обладают отдельными ресурсами и изолированы друг от друга. Это означает, что если другие пользователи на физическом сервере испытывают проблемы, это не оказывает влияния на работу ваших веб-приложений. В случае сбоя в системе, виртуальный сервер будет перезапущен автоматически, обеспечивая минимальное время простоя и поддерживая доступность вашего приложения для пользователей.
Кроме того, VPS обычно предоставляет возможность установки и настройки нужного программного обеспечения и инструментов, что позволяет веб-разработчикам создавать и запускать приложения в соответствии со своими требованиями и предпочтениями. Это дает большую гибкость и контроль над разработкой и обеспечивает соблюдение требуемых стандартов и процедур без ограничений, которые могут быть связаны с использованием общих хостинговых решений.
В целом, использование VPS для разработки и развертывания веб-приложений обеспечивает доступность и надежность, что является важными факторами для любого веб-разработчика. В сочетании с другими преимуществами, такими как масштабируемость и безопасность, VPS является отличным выбором для создания и запуска веб-приложений.
Возможность удаленного доступа и управления
С VPS вы получаете полный контроль над сервером, на котором размещено ваше приложение. Вы можете удаленно подключаться к серверу, используя различные протоколы, такие как SSH, Remote Desktop или FTP.
Это облегчает сопровождение и обновление вашего веб-приложения. Вы можете вносить изменения в код, добавлять новые функции и обновлять платформу, всё из любой точки мира, где доступен Интернет.
Кроме того, возможность удаленного доступа и управления позволяет вам мониторить и отлаживать ваше приложение в режиме реального времени. Вы можете просматривать логи, проверять работу базы данных и при необходимости вносить исправления.
Другим важным аспектом удаленного доступа является возможность масштабирования. При росте вашего веб-приложения вы можете добавлять новые серверы или увеличивать ресурсы текущего сервера, всё без необходимости физического присутствия на месте.
Преимущества | Возможности |
---|---|
Удаленный доступ | Подключение через SSH, Remote Desktop или FTP |
Управление | Внесение изменений, обновление приложения, мониторинг и отладка |
Масштабирование | Добавление новых серверов или увеличение ресурсов текущего сервера |
Таким образом, благодаря возможности удаленного доступа и управления, VPS обеспечивает веб-разработчикам удобную и гибкую среду для разработки, развертывания и масштабирования своих веб-приложений.
Гарантированная доступность и высокая скорость работы
При использовании VPS веб-разработчики получают гарантированную доступность и высокую скорость работы своих веб-приложений.
Одной из главных преимуществ VPS является возможность полного контроля над виртуальным сервером, а это значит, что разработчик может самостоятельно настроить окружение и ресурсы под нужды своего проекта. Это позволяет гарантировать стабильную работу приложения и надежность, так как разработчик сам отвечает за его конфигурацию и обслуживание.
Высокая скорость работы веб-приложений на VPS обеспечивается за счет отдельного выделенного ресурса процессора и оперативной памяти. Виртуальный сервер не затрудняется работой других приложений, что позволяет достичь высокой производительности и быстрого отклика приложения на запросы пользователей.
Также важно отметить, что VPS работает на основе SSD-накопителей, которые обеспечивают высокую скорость чтения и записи данных. Это позволяет ускорить загрузку веб-страниц и сократить время отклика при работе с базой данных.
Гарантированная доступность и высокая скорость работы VPS являются ключевыми факторами для успешного функционирования веб-приложений. Благодаря этим преимуществам разработчики могут обеспечить высокое качество работы своих проектов и удовлетворить потребности пользователей.